How do I choose the right antiseptic?
Consider the type of injury and your skin sensitivities. For minor cuts, a topical antiseptic like Betadine is effective, while for larger wounds, antiseptic sprays might be more suitable.

Can I use antiseptics on children?
Many antiseptics are safe for children, but it's essential to check the product label for age recommendations and possible allergens before use.

How should I store antibiotics and antiseptics?
Store these products in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ight to maintain their effectiveness. Always follow specific storage instructions on the label.

How do I apply topical antibiotics or antiseptics?
Clean the affected area before application, then apply a thin layer of the product as directed, usually 1-3 times a day, and cover with a bandage if necessary.
